Output 907451db127670f31c0e68a6fbe53b4abaa9e76ef0b9aae5fc7d91e94f7afcd7:34

value
166000
script pubkey
OP_0 OP_PUSHBYTES_20 e5a84ed119d43f542934d2c661f1e76dbabaf5b1
address
bc1quk5ya5ge6sl4g2f56trxru08dkat4ad3trxuac
transaction
907451db127670f31c0e68a6fbe53b4abaa9e76ef0b9aae5fc7d91e94f7afcd7
spent
true